- [ ] **Step 7: Breaker override escrow.** After sealing the signing keys for the Tallgrove upstream API circuit breaker, confirm the support team can force the breaker open during a full outage. The override bundle lives in the sealed escrow drawer and is useless without its unlock phrase. Two ceremony witnesses must initial this step before proceeding. The escrow bundle is decrypted with the recovery passphrase that follows.

vault phrase of kahip-kahop = holath-quenmir

Subject: AddressPilot cut-over complete

The AddressPilot autocomplete widget is now fully serving from the Veldmark cluster; the legacy endpoint was drained last night with no user-facing errors. Suggestion latency is back under target and cache hit rates look healthy. For your records, the production configuration now in effect is listed below.

service settings:
[casax]
port = 6379
team = rusir
host = casax.zemvarhq.corp
region = outer-4
access_code = ac_9808ce
timeout_ms = 1500

## Deploying the Gatewick Proctor Queue

Deploys are pretty painless: push to main, wait for the pipeline, then watch the queue drain dashboard for five minutes. If candidates pile up mid-exam, roll back first and ask questions later — the queue replays safely. Everything the workers care about lives in one config block, shown here for reference.

settings of bafof-yagef:
JOROX_PIN=8740
JOROX_TENANT=pelox
JOROX_METRICS_HOST=metrics.jorox.qorvelworks.internal
JOROX_SEAL=seal_c78f63c1
JOROX_STANDBY_TEAM=norax

Handover note — Crumbwheel order cutoffs.

Welcome aboard. The bakery cutoff rule in Crumbwheel closes same-day orders at 14:00 local to each storefront, not UTC — this has bitten us twice. Holiday overrides live in the calendar service and take precedence silently, so always check there first when a cutoff looks wrong. To unlock the calendar service's admin console after a restart, enter the recovery passphrase below.

vault phrase of bagap-bahaf = silion-pelox-sorox-casdor-quenwyn-fraax-eliox-praael-kelion-quenvan-kasox-rusael-norius-belvan